The Departments practice is to exclude the personal details of staff not in the Senior Executive Service (SES), as well as the direct contact details of SES staff, contained in documents that fall within scope of an FOI request. Blacktown City has welcomed hundreds of Australia's newest citizens, including an expectant mother from her hospital bed, at virtual ceremonies during the COVID-19 lockdown.
